8. Stockholders’ Equity

Performance Stock Units

In March 2024, the Company began to issue performance stock units (PSU) with a market condition that are earned based on the Company’s rTSR as compared to a peer group of companies measured over a three-year performance period and continued employment through the performance period. Depending on the actual performance over the measurement period, a rTSR PSU award recipient could receive up to 150% of the granted award. The grant date fair value of such awards is estimated using a Monte Carlo simulation, which includes assumptions such as expected volatility, risk-free interest rate and dividend yield. These unobservable inputs represent a Level 3 measurement because they are supported by little or no market activity and reflect the Company’s own assumptions in measuring fair value. The compensation expense for the awards is recognized over the requisite service period regardless of whether the market conditions are achieved and will only be adjusted for pre-vesting forfeitures due to the termination of the recipient’s employment with the Company prior to the end of the performance period.

Contingent Cash Awards

In November 2021, the Company established a plan whereby substantially all full-time employees excluding executive management are eligible to receive a series of cash bonuses over certain periods based on continued employment and the Company’s stock price reaching a pre-specified target. The maximum potential payout of the cash awards at the grant date was $15.1 million. The Company has determined that the cash awards were classified as liabilities pursuant to ASC Topic 718, Compensation – Stock Compensation. The Company estimates the fair value of the awards at each reporting period using a Monte Carlo simulation, which is recognized as compensation cost over the derived service period. Total fair value of the awards at the grant date was $4.4 million. The maximum potential payout at September 30, 2024 after adjusting for forfeitures was $9.2 million. However, due to the decrease of the Company’s stock price, the potential payout was deemed unlikely of being earned. Therefore, the fair value of the awards at September 30, 2024 was approximately $0.0 million. During the three and nine months ended September 30, 2024, the Company recorded a reversal of $0.0 million and $4.5 million of compensation cost related to the awards, respectively. During the three months ended September 30, 2023, the Company recorded a reversal of $1.0 million of compensation cost related to the awards. During the nine months ended September 30, 2023, the Company recorded a total of $0.2 million of compensation cost related to the awards. The awards were forfeited in November 2024 as the Company’s stock price did not reach the pre-specified target.

2024 Equity Incentive Plan

The Company’s 2024 Equity Incentive Plan (the 2024 Plan) became effective upon approval of the stockholders in May 2024. The 2024 Plan permits the grant of awards to employees, non-employee directors and consultants. In addition, the 2024 Plan permits the grant of stock options, stock appreciation rights, restricted stock awards, restricted stock unit awards, performance awards, and other awards. The 2024 Plan provides that, with limited exceptions, no award will vest until at least 12 months following the date of grant of the award; provided, however, that up to 5% of the aggregate number of shares that may be issued under the 2024 Plan may be subject to awards which do not meet such vesting requirements. The maximum term of any stock option or stock appreciation right awards under 2024 Plan is ten years. All shares that remained eligible for grant under the Company’s 2010 Equity Incentive Plan and 2023 Inducement Plan at the time of approval of the 2024 Plan were transferred to the 2024 Plan.

2024 Inducement Plan

The Board adopted the Company’s 2024 Inducement Plan (Inducement Plan) in September 2024. The Inducement Plan permits the grant of stock options, stock appreciation rights, restricted stock awards, restricted stock unit awards, performance awards and other stock-related awards. Stock awards granted under the Inducement Plan may only be made to individuals who did not previously serve as employees or non-employee directors of the Company or an affiliate of the Company. In addition, stock awards must be approved by either a majority of the Company’s independent directors or the Compensation Committee. The terms of the Inducement Plan are otherwise substantially similar to the 2024 Plan. The maximum number of shares of Company common stock that may be issued under the Inducement Plan is 2,400,000 shares. At September 30, 2024, there were 1,805,595 shares available for new grants.
